Blog Category
21 March, 2025

Crafting Effective Developer Tools to Boost Team Productivity

Crafting Effective Developer Tools to Boost Team Productivity

Crafting Effective Developer Tools to Boost Team Productivity

Why Developer Tooling Matters

When it comes to building effective systems for teams, especially in environments geared towards integrations, automation software, and B2B websites designed for lead generation through SEO, developer tooling isn't just an asset—it's a necessity. Think of developer tooling as the paintbrush for the digital artist; it's what allows our developers to craft stunning, high-performance applications with ease and precision.

In my work, I've encountered countless teams where the right tools have been the key difference between meeting project deadlines or running late. Enhanced productivity through tailored tools is not just about reducing the time spent on mundane tasks; it's about fostering an environment where creativity can flourish. When developers are armed with intuitive, powerful tools, they're better positioned to innovate and push boundaries. Whether we're discussing custom software development for enterprise solutions or optimizing automation software, understanding and implementing the right developer tools can be transformative.

Custom Software Development for Developer Tooling

The world of custom software development offers a vast array of possibilities for developer tooling. Every team has its unique workflow, which often necessitates equally unique solutions. For instance, I've guided firms through the process of developing custom version control systems that align more seamlessly with their project structures, allowing them to not only manage their code but also how teams collaborate on it. According to TechCrunch, custom tools built around a team's specific needs can lead to a 20% increase in productivity, a testament to the tailored approach in software development.

Imagine a scenario where a team dedicated to B2B web development needs a tool to automate the deployment process for their lead generation-focused websites. That's where custom software development steps in—creating specialized tools to streamline the continuous integration and deployment processes. These custom-developed solutions optimize workflows, enhance security measures, and ultimately help scale SEO efforts effectively. From build automation to performance testing tools, investing in developer tooling customized to your business's particular demands is essential for staying ahead in competitive markets.

Integrating Automation Software with Developer Tooling

Integrations in modern enterprise solutions are essential, and when paired with robust automation software, they act as accelerators for team productivity. Automation tools such as continuous integration servers can revolutionize how a team collaborates, transforming what might have been a tedious manual process into something largely automated and error-free. I've seen firsthand how these integrations eliminate the bottleneck of waiting for merges, building trust within the team as code changes flow more predictably and reliably.

In the context of business automation, Forrester research underscores the importance of automation in reducing costs and human error while improving time-to-market. For firms operating in sectors like finance or healthcare, where regulations and compliance are paramount, customized automation tools can integrate seamlessly with existing systems to meet these unique challenges. Embracing automation software as a component of developer tooling not only boosts productivity but also establishes consistency across different platforms and applications.

The Role of B2B Websites and SEO-Focused Developer Tooling

Building B2B websites optimized for lead generation via SEO is another area where developer tooling plays a critical role. Developer tools like static site generators or frameworks can significantly reduce load times and improve SEO performance, all while keeping the site architecture clean and maintainable. From my experience, implementing SEO-friendly tools at the design and development stage pays off through better search engine rankings and, subsequently, more qualified leads for businesses.

While tools exist that help developers create highly performant websites, understanding the nuances of SEO—from site speed optimization to proper meta tag usage—means that tailoring these tools further can enhance their effectiveness. Analytics tools integrated into a developer's workflow can provide real-time SEO insights, enabling iterative improvements to cater specifically to customer acquisition strategies.

Challenges and Best Practices in Developer Tooling

Despite the advantages, the path to integrating effective developer tooling is not without its challenges. Tools can become outdated or might not fully integrate with existing workflows. My recommendation, based on available research, is to invest in continuous education and trial of new tools; what works today may not suffice tomorrow. Moreover, the suitability of a tool can vary widely depending on team size, development methodology, and business goals. It's a delicate balance between adopting trending technologies and maintaining what genuinely works for the specific needs of a business.

To implement developer tools effectively, teams should consider an iterative approach—start small, test rigorously, and scale up. Best practices include regular reviews and updates to the tooling ecosystem, fostering open communication about pain points and efficiencies gained, and training programs to ensure all team members are leveraging tools to their maximum potential. Consulting with tech leaders or reading case studies from firms like Google or IBM can shed light on how top players in the industry approach developer tooling, offering insights into methodologies and tools that have proven effective.

Leveraging Open-Source Tools and Community Resources

One of the beauties of developer tooling is the wealth of open-source tools and vibrant community resources available. I often encourage teams to leverage these assets to build their developer ecosystems. From frameworks like React or Angular to CI/CD tools like Jenkins, open-source communities have put forth powerful and freely available solutions that can be invaluable for teams focusing on integrations, automation, and SEO-optimized websites.

Community forums, developer documentation, and even direct communication with project maintainers can provide not just tools but also real-world insights on implementation and optimization. Leveraging this collective knowledge enhances the reach of a development team beyond its internal resources. All the while, there's potential to contribute back, potentially opening avenues for innovation and collaboration within the broader tech ecosystem.

Future Trends in Developer Tooling for Teams

Looking ahead, the future of developer tooling is fertile ground for innovation. I keep an eye on trends like AI-assisted code completion, which promises to speed up development tasks and enhance the developer experience significantly. Gartner's prediction that by 2025, 80% of software engineers will use AI coding assistants is a clear signal of what's coming.

Further ahead, the rise of low/no-code platforms presents an intriguing dimension for developer tooling. While these platforms don't necessarily replace traditional coding, they offer supplementary tools that teams can integrate into their toolkit to accelerate certain aspects of development, such as prototyping or generating basic UI elements, often supporting integrations crucial for seamless business operations.

Conclusion: Building a Robust Developer Ecosystem

The approach to developer tooling involves not just selection but a thoughtful integration into the daily operations of teams focused on building integrations, automation solutions, and SEO-rich B2B websites. It requires an ongoing commitment to assess, adjust, and advance based on tangible business outcomes. As we craft and refine our developer tooling ecosystems, we not only enhance our operational efficiency but open up new possibilities for innovation and competitive edge.